Ras Caleb Appiah-Levi: A Revolutionary Force Reviving the Pan-African Spirit

Ras Caleb Appiah-Levi stands as a towering figure in the modern Pan-African movement — a man driven by purpose, heritage, and an unshakable belief in African unity and self-determination. Known not only for his powerful voice in reggae music but also for his tireless advocacy, Ras Caleb is transforming Pan-Africanism from a fading ideal into a living, breathing movement that speaks directly to the soul of Africa’s youth and future.

Through cultural activism, grassroots mobilisation, and relentless advocacy, Ras Caleb is redefining what it means to be Pan-African in the 21st century. He has revived the forgotten legacies of Kwame Nkrumah, Marcus Garvey, and Haile Selassie, not just in speech but in action — organising forums, creating platforms for African voices, and demanding that Africa rise above neo-colonial chains.

His approach is not about empty rhetoric but about concrete steps: promoting African unity, economic cooperation, cultural pride, and youth empowerment. Ras Caleb believes that Pan-Africanism must live in our communities, in our economies, and in our education systems — not just on paper.

He is currently leading initiatives to bring Pan-Africanism into schools, music, art, and local governance. His efforts are centred on reclaiming African identity, fostering continental solidarity, and ensuring that Africans lead African development.

Ras Caleb’s message is clear: Africa must unite or perish. Through his bold vision, unwavering commitment, and Rastafarian-rooted wisdom, he is making Pan-Africanism relevant again, not just as a political ideology but as a lifestyle, a solution, and a legacy for generations to come.

Counsellor D Y Donkoh Apologizes to Shatta Wale Over Prophecy

Counsellor D Y Donkoh has issued a public apology to Ghanaian music star Shatta Wale after sharing a prophecy that reportedly left the artist “visibly shaken and traumatised.”

In a statement dated July 27, 2025, Donkoh admitted the prophecy—shared on social media—sparked widespread concern and was never meant to cause fear.

 

He expressed regret and pledged to be more cautious when sharing future revelations.

Legendary Highlife Musician Daddy Lumba Passes Away — Family Announces Vigil and Book of Condolence

The Fosu Family Mourns the Loss of Charles Kwadwo Fosu (Daddy Lumba)

 

The Fosu family has announced, with deep sorrow, the passing of Charles Kwadwo Fosu, famously known as Daddy Lumba, after a brief illness.

 

In a public statement released on July 27, 2025, by Baba Jamal & Associates, legal consultants for the Fosu family, they extended their heartfelt appreciation to fans, friends, colleagues, and the general public for the overwhelming support and love shown since the sad news broke.

 

Daddy Lumba was a true icon of Ghanaian highlife music, celebrated for his unique style, unmatched vocal talent, and immense contribution to the music industry.

Ghana to Host Global Candlelight Vigil in Honour of Highlife Legend Daddy Lumba

The Creative Arts Agency has announced a National Candlelight Vigil in memory of Ghanaian highlife music legend Daddy Lumba, set to take place on August 2, 2025, at Independence Square in Accra.

 

This significant event will run from 6:00 PM to 10:00 PM and forms part of a global tribute being held simultaneously in Ghana, Germany, the United Kingdom, the United States, and the Netherlands.

 

The vigil is being organized to honour the life, legacy, and immense contribution of Daddy Lumba to Ghana’s music and cultural landscape. Known for his distinctive voice and timeless songs, Daddy Lumba remains one of Ghana’s most celebrated music icons.

 

In a letter signed by Mr. Gideon Aryeequaye, Acting Executive Secretary of the Creative Arts Agency, the public is warmly invited to join in this solemn and inspirational event.
